What are the most common Lexus repair issues for drivers in the Severn, NC area?

In Severn, common issues include suspension wear from rural road conditions and HVAC system problems due to high humidity. Lexus models may also experience early brake rotor warping from frequent stop-and-go driving on routes like US-158. Regular checks on these systems are advised.

How can I find a reputable, specialized Lexus repair shop near Severn?

Look for shops in nearby towns like Roanoke Rapids or Murfreesboro that employ ASE-certified technicians with specific Lexus/Toyota training. Verify they use genuine or OEM-quality parts and have strong local reviews, as Severn itself has limited dedicated dealership options.

Are Lexus repair costs higher in our rural Severn area compared to larger cities?

Labor rates may be slightly lower than in Raleigh, but parts availability can sometimes cause delays, potentially increasing diagnostic time. Building a relationship with a local trusted shop can lead to more predictable pricing and priority service.

When should I seek local service versus going to a distant Lexus dealership?

For routine maintenance, oil changes, brakes, and most repairs, a qualified local independent shop is sufficient and more convenient. For complex hybrid system issues, advanced diagnostics, or warranty work, the nearest dealerships in the greater Greenville, NC area may be necessary.

What local driving conditions in the Severn region should influence my Lexus maintenance schedule?

The mix of dusty rural roads and high summer heat can accelerate air filter wear and stress cooling systems. It's wise to check cabin and engine air filters more frequently and ensure your cooling system is serviced to prevent overheating during humid summers.
